Grafana--监控数据展示神器

网友投稿 254 2022-09-28

Grafana--监控数据展示神器

1. 前言

Grafana是一款用Go语言开发的开源数据可视化工具,可以做数据监控和数据统计,带有告警功能,可以分析指标和日志。使用Grafana可以制作出漂亮的仪表面板,它是一个炫酷的可视化监控、分析利器。无论我们的数据在哪里,或者数据所处的数据库是什么类型,都可以将它们与Grafana精美地结合在一起。    Grafana软件版本当前已经更新到Grafana8,但是目前用的比较多的是Grafana6和Grafana7,各个版本绘制图形面板的时候语法会有差别,本文将以Grafana7进行讲解,介绍其安装以及使用。

2. 安装

2.1 软件安装

wget https://dl.grafana.com/enterprise/release/grafana-enterprise-7.2.0-1.x86_64.rpm yum install grafana-enterprise-7.2.0-1.x86_64.rpm -y systemctl start grafana-server

安装完毕后,使用IP地址+3000端口即可登录,默认用户名和密码均为:admin,第一次登录会提示修改密码。

2.2 插件安装

# 饼图插件 grafana-cli plugins install grafana-piechart-panel # 时钟插件 grafana-cli plugins install grafana-clock-panel # zabbix插件 grafana-cli plugins install alexanderzobnin-zabbix-app systemctl restart grafana-server

2.3 Grafana相关文件和目录

Grafana安装完成后会生成一些文件

/etc/grafana/grafana.ini Grafana配置文件 /var/log/grafana/grafana.log Grafana日志文件 /var/lib/grafana/grafana.db Grafana数据保存文件 /var/lib/grafana/plugins/ Grafana插件保存目录

3. 数据保存形式

3.1 数据源

3.2 Panels(图形面板)

3.3 Query editors(查询编辑器)

4. 可视化

当我们绘制图形时,需要选择合适的可视化方式(Visualization)。Grafana 提供了多种可视化来支持不同的用例,这一部分将重点介绍内置面板、它们的选项和典型用法。    Grafana支持的可视化方式有:Graph、Stat、Gauge、Bar gauge、Table、Text、Heatmap、Alert list、Dashboard list、News、Pie Chart、Logs。本文将着重介绍使用得比较多的几个可视化。

4.1 Graph

4.2 Gauge

4.3 Stat

4.4 Table

4.5 Pie chart

5.用户管理

6.案例演示

6.1 制作Panel

6.2 导入模板

完整的json文件参考:https://github.com/Rainbowhhy/Grafana_dashboard

参考文档

版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系我们jiasou666@gmail.com 处理,核实后本网站将在24小时内删除侵权内容。

上一篇:多功能物联网网关应用于巴歇尔槽流量采集
下一篇:Java 集合框架 Queue 和 Stack 体系
相关文章

 发表评论

暂时没有评论,来抢沙发吧~